With all this wonderful talk of politics,
Does the MVPA contribute to any lobbying organizations? Since MV's are
finally getting their just due in "regular" circles of collecting,
shouldn't we try to get some of our particular issues added to the general
concern of the membership of some of the large car groups? Again, not
wanting to be on the "fringe," but just wanting to stop some of the
stupidity, like demilling hummers, putting the M35's on the munitions list,
etc.

Finally, does anybody remember that big yellow Autocar aircraft crash
truck at the Don Siver/ Coatesville auction this year? I want to report
that it is running and operating, although without rear brakes and use of
the choke. We are still looking for a Zenith 457-2 Carbeuretor choke plate
shaft to make it start better- tying a BDU hat to a rope and yanking it out
of the carb when it coughs is getting old....
